Azerbaijan simplifies customs declaration rules for imported cars
Business
- 13 December, 2022
- 08:20
The State Customs Committee plans to simplify the rules for declaring cars imported into the country at customs, according to Report.
"Euro-4 standards are already being assigned to cars electronically. Work is underway in the direction I have noted. It is not necessary to bring cars to customs points," First Deputy Chairman of the State Customs Committee, Acting Chairman Shahin Baghirov said at a meeting of the Milli Majlis (Parliament) Committee on Economic Policy, Industry and Entrepreneurship.
